Question
Refer to the exhibit. A midsize company is running a traditional iSCSI storage infrastructure on a set of Cisco UCS B200 M6 servers, which are connected to a Cisco MDS 9124 SAN fabric. The infrastructure includes a VMware ESXi supervisor, and each host creates iSCSI/VMHBA adapters to link the physical NICs to their respective VMkernel ports. Which action must the engineering team take to improve the performance and scalability of the iSCSI storage infrastructure?

Explanation
Enabling iSCSI multipathing on the ESXi hosts lets each VMkernel iSCSI adapter use all available NIC–network paths in parallel - boosting throughput, providing automatic failover, and improving scalability. Neither LACP nor generic NIC teaming applies to software iSCSI; MPIO is the VMware-supported mechanism.
